2. Module objectives/intended learning outcomes
This course introduces the fundamental concepts and methodologies of machine learning (ML), with a strong emphasis on practical applications in areas such as:
Signal processing and biomedical applications, including EEG, ECG, and sensor data;
Computer vision;
Natural language processing (NLP);
Recommender systems;
Industrial data analytics.
Students will acquire foundational knowledge of supervised and unsupervised learning, including classification, regression, and clustering, as well as modern approaches such as ensemble learning and artificial neural networks.
The course provides an in-depth understanding of the complete machine learning application development lifecycle, including data collection, preprocessing, model development, evaluation, deployment, and monitoring. It establishes an essential foundation for advanced courses such as Deep Learning, Image Processing, Natural Language Processing, and Data Mining, while preparing students to apply ML techniques to scientific and technological research projects and industry-oriented applications.
